Lenalidomide in Combination With R-DA-EPOCH in Patients With Untreated DLBCL With MYC Rearrangement

The prognosis of DLBCL with MYC rearrangement is dismal. Previous study showed that lenalidomide in combination with R-CHOP showed promising therapeutic activity and that R-DA EPOCH was superior compared to R-CHOP regimen in this cohort of patients. The investigators therefore design this phase I/II study to investigate the safety and efficacy of lenalidomide in combination with R-DA EPOCH in patients with untreated MYC-rearranged DLBCL.
